Ultra-processed food tied to higher prostate cancer risk

A Florida Atlantic University analysis of 17,024 US men found that those getting more of their calories from ultra-processed foods reported prostate cancer 29% more often, though the survey design cannot show which came first.

Men who got more of their daily calories from ultra-processed foods reported prostate cancer about 29% more often than men who ate the least, according to a study of 17,024 US men published August 7 in The American Journal of Medicine. Researchers at Florida Atlantic University’s Charles E. Schmidt College of Medicine pulled the numbers from the National Health and Nutrition Examination Survey, or NHANES, covering 2003 through 2023.

The catch sits in the design. NHANES asked men what they ate and whether they had ever been told they had prostate cancer, and the cancer count came from self-report rather than medical records.

Key takeaways

  • Men in the top three quarters of ultra-processed food intake had about 29% higher odds of prostate cancer than men in the bottom quarter. There is about a 3 in 100 chance a gap that size showed up by luck alone (p = 0.031).
  • After the researchers accounted for age, smoking, race and ethnicity, and poverty status, the increases were about 27%, 31%, and 34% depending on which intake groups were compared.
  • The heaviest consumers alone showed the largest jump, 34%, but that one did not clear the bar for statistical significance.

What the study found

The team used two 24-hour dietary recalls and the NOVA classification system to work out what share of each man’s calories came from ultra-processed foods: soft drinks, packaged cereals and snacks, processed meats, and similar products. They then split the men into four equal-sized groups by that share.

Compared with the lowest group, men in the combined second, third, and fourth quarters had about a 29% higher risk (p = 0.031). Men in the combined top two quarters had about a 30% higher risk, with roughly a 3.5 in 100 chance of being coincidence (p = 0.035). Men in the top quarter on their own showed about a 31% higher risk, but that estimate could plausibly have been chance (p = 0.079).

After adjustment, the same three comparisons came out at about 27% (p = 0.045), 31% (p = 0.037), and 34% (p = 0.072). The authors attribute the weaker showing in the top group alone to the smaller number of prostate cancer cases there.

One methods choice deserves attention. The authors used 90% confidence intervals to test for significance “as harm was prespecified.” That is looser than the 95% intervals most medical journals expect, and it makes a borderline result easier to call real.

Dr. Kumar’s take

The headline treats this as a story about diet causing cancer. The data cannot carry that.

NHANES is a snapshot. A man’s two days of diet recall and his answer about a cancer diagnosis come from the same visit. Nothing here establishes that the ultra-processed eating came before the tumor.

Then there is detection. Prostate cancer is found largely because someone ordered a PSA test. Men who see a doctor regularly and engage with preventive care get screened more, and they also tend to eat less ultra-processed food. Adjusting for poverty status catches some of that, but it does not separate screening intensity from cancer incidence. Part of this signal may be who got tested rather than who got sick.

Note also that the university’s news release described the adjusted increases as ranging from 24% to 31%, while the published abstract lists 27%, 31%, and 34%. Reporters have been quoting the release.

None of this makes ultra-processed food harmless. The pattern shows up across too many outcomes to dismiss, including weaker attention and higher dementia risk and a 47% higher risk of heart disease. This particular study is a reason to fund a proper prospective study, not a reason to say packaged snacks give men prostate cancer. The senior author says the same thing, calling for “large-scale observational studies and randomized trials to adequately test the hypothesis.”

What it means for you

Do not change your prostate cancer screening plan because of this paper. Screening decisions rest on age, family history, race, and your own preferences about an ambiguous result, and none of that moved this week.

The reasonable move is the one that was already reasonable. Swapping packaged snacks and soft drinks for food you recognize is a good bet on general grounds. Whether it changes your prostate risk is an open question.
